TOWER OF LONDON

The Tower of London was first a castle, later a prison and is now a

museum where you can see the

Crown Jewels.

ST. PAUL'S CATHEDRAL AND WESTMINSTER ABBEY

St. Paul's Cathedral was designed by Sir Christopher Wren.

Westminster Abbey is the place where the kings and queens are crowned.
